Chemical Composition and in vitro Schistosomicidal Activity of the Essential Oil of Plectranthus neochilus Grown in Southeast Brazil
Abstract
The chemical composition and the in vitro schistosomicidal effects of the essential oil of Plectranthus neochilus (PN‐EO) grown in Southeast Brazil was studied. β ‐Caryophyllene ( 1 ; 28.23%), α ‐thujene ( 2 ; 12.22%), α ‐pinene ( 3 ; 12.63%), β ‐pinene ( 4 ; 6.19%), germacrene D ( 5 ; 5.36%), and caryophyllene oxide ( 6 ; 5.37%) were the major essential oil constituents.
